House leveling services involve adjusting and stabilizing a structure's foundation to correct uneven or settling conditions. These projects typically address issues such as cracked walls, uneven floors, or doors and windows that no longer close properly. Property owners often seek house leveling when noticing signs of foundation movement, especially in areas prone to soil shifting or moisture changes, to prevent further damage and maintain the stability of the home.

Common House Leveling Jobs

Foundation Repair - stabilizes and restores the integrity of a settling or cracked foundation.

Slab Leveling - lifts and levels uneven concrete slabs in driveways, patios, and walkways.

Pier and Beam Leveling - corrects uneven or sagging floors caused by shifting piers or beams.

Basement Leveling - addresses uneven basement floors to prevent further structural issues.

Crawl Space Stabilization - improves support and prevents settling in crawl space areas.

Structural Adjustment - realigns and supports the home’s framing for improved stability.

House Leveling Questions

What is house leveling? House leveling involves adjusting the foundation to correct uneven settling and restore stability.

When is house leveling needed? It is typically required when there are noticeable cracks, uneven floors, or doors that won't close properly.

What methods are used for house leveling? Common methods include piering, mudjacking, or underpinning to lift and stabilize the foundation.

What signs indicate foundation issues? Signs include cracked walls, sticking doors or windows, and uneven or sloping floors.
